Ticket #2093 — Vault locked during cron drift investigation

While digging into the Fennick scheduler's cron drift (jobs firing ~4 minutes late since Saturday), the diagnostics vault auto-locked after the session timed out. Can't pull the timing logs without it. Drift is still unexplained; suspect NTP on the Harlowe node. Support: don't restart the scheduler until logs are reviewed. To reopen the vault and continue, enter the passphrase below.

unlock words, bahop-fawef: novmir-druwyn-soriel-rusdor-kasion

Facilities ticket — Halewick Tower, night shift.

Issue: support team reporting east stairwell reader rejecting badges after midnight. Reader was reset this morning; firmware updated. Overnight crew should now badge as normal. If the reader fails again, use the manual keypad by the fire door — do not prop the door. Log any further failures with the time and badge name. Temporary keypad code for the fallback door is below.

door code, tajeg-fawip: bdg-K-62

**Vendor note: Inkmill markdown pipeline**

Rendering for Parchway docs is outsourced to Inkmill under an annual contract, renewing each March. They handle sanitization and PDF export; we own the upload queue. SLA: 4-hour response on rendering failures. Escalate only after two failed retries. Their support desk is reachable at the address below.

billing contact of hahaf-baguf = zorael.tammir.jorius@sivrelhq.internal

To the release manager: I'm passing ownership of the Pellwick deep-link router to Sorrel before the 4.2 cut. The intent-matching table now lives in the Farrowgate config service; stale entries were purged last sprint. Watch the fallback route — it silently swallows malformed slugs, which inflated our drop-off metrics in March. The staging resolver needs its keystore unlocked before each regression pass, and that keystore accepts only one credential. For the signing vault, the recovery phrase is noted directly below.

recovery phrase for tafog-fafog: novix-novdor-fraath-brieth-olieth-oliix-rusix-wenion-julax-druox